From 4fc3c52e408436759bc017b1b7fefa3dae64b1ce Mon Sep 17 00:00:00 2001 From: adiao <1819192616@qq.com> Date: Wed, 28 Sep 2022 02:13:08 +0800 Subject: [PATCH] Initial commit --- src/main/java/BeanScope/StudentController.java | 3 +++ src/main/java/BeanScope/StudentServiceImple.java | 3 +++ src/main/java/BeanScope/studentDao/StudentDao.java | 2 ++ .../depositModel/Controller/OrderController.java | 4 ++-- .../depositModel/Service/ChangService.java | 13 +++++++++++++ .../depositModel/Service/imple/DbDaoImple.java | 2 +- src/main/resources/DepModelClassMapper.xml | 8 ++++++++ src/main/resources/DepModelClassMapperS.xml | 9 +++++++++ 8 files changed, 41 insertions(+), 3 deletions(-) create mode 100644 src/main/resources/DepModelClassMapper.xml create mode 100644 src/main/resources/DepModelClassMapperS.xml diff --git a/src/main/java/BeanScope/StudentController.java b/src/main/java/BeanScope/StudentController.java index 5407b5a..928c747 100644 --- a/src/main/java/BeanScope/StudentController.java +++ b/src/main/java/BeanScope/StudentController.java @@ -2,6 +2,9 @@ package BeanScope; import org.springframework.stereotype.Controller; +/** + * @author adiao + */ @Controller public class StudentController { diff --git a/src/main/java/BeanScope/StudentServiceImple.java b/src/main/java/BeanScope/StudentServiceImple.java index 8e7531f..286b0a6 100644 --- a/src/main/java/BeanScope/StudentServiceImple.java +++ b/src/main/java/BeanScope/StudentServiceImple.java @@ -3,6 +3,9 @@ package BeanScope; import BeanScope.studentService.StudentService; import org.springframework.stereotype.Service; +/** + * @author adiao + */ @Service public class StudentServiceImple implements StudentService { @Override diff --git a/src/main/java/BeanScope/studentDao/StudentDao.java b/src/main/java/BeanScope/studentDao/StudentDao.java index d27ae4b..1c20765 100644 --- a/src/main/java/BeanScope/studentDao/StudentDao.java +++ b/src/main/java/BeanScope/studentDao/StudentDao.java @@ -2,6 +2,8 @@ package BeanScope.studentDao; /** * 数据操作方法 + * + * @author adiao */ public interface StudentDao { diff --git a/src/main/java/com/jd/springboot/depositModel/Controller/OrderController.java b/src/main/java/com/jd/springboot/depositModel/Controller/OrderController.java index c6b7035..4d32b9c 100644 --- a/src/main/java/com/jd/springboot/depositModel/Controller/OrderController.java +++ b/src/main/java/com/jd/springboot/depositModel/Controller/OrderController.java @@ -14,8 +14,8 @@ import javax.annotation.Resource; @Controller public class OrderController { - @Resource + @Resource(name = "changService") public void show() { - + System.out.println("这里的更改业务中显示方法已被重写。"); } } diff --git a/src/main/java/com/jd/springboot/depositModel/Service/ChangService.java b/src/main/java/com/jd/springboot/depositModel/Service/ChangService.java index 80c3e6a..b065395 100644 --- a/src/main/java/com/jd/springboot/depositModel/Service/ChangService.java +++ b/src/main/java/com/jd/springboot/depositModel/Service/ChangService.java @@ -8,13 +8,26 @@ package com.jd.springboot.depositModel.Service; import com.jd.springboot.depositModel.Dao.ChangServiceDao; +import com.jd.springboot.depositModel.Service.imple.DbDaoImple; +import org.springframework.stereotype.Service; + +import javax.annotation.Resource; /** * 定义业务1 * * @author adiao */ +@Service("changService") public class ChangService implements ChangServiceDao { + + @Resource(name = "DaoImple") + private DbDaoImple dbDaoImple; + + public ChangService(DbDaoImple dbDaoImple) { + this.dbDaoImple = dbDaoImple; + } + /** * 重写 */ diff --git a/src/main/java/com/jd/springboot/depositModel/Service/imple/DbDaoImple.java b/src/main/java/com/jd/springboot/depositModel/Service/imple/DbDaoImple.java index f0b52c9..acbf520 100644 --- a/src/main/java/com/jd/springboot/depositModel/Service/imple/DbDaoImple.java +++ b/src/main/java/com/jd/springboot/depositModel/Service/imple/DbDaoImple.java @@ -15,7 +15,7 @@ import org.springframework.stereotype.Repository; * * @author adiao */ -@Repository +@Repository("DaoImple") public class DbDaoImple implements DbDao { /** * back withe add Function. diff --git a/src/main/resources/DepModelClassMapper.xml b/src/main/resources/DepModelClassMapper.xml new file mode 100644 index 0000000..48dc1da --- /dev/null +++ b/src/main/resources/DepModelClassMapper.xml @@ -0,0 +1,8 @@ + + + + +